Abstract
The goal of the paper is to discuss comparisons in RSA and Triple DES algorithms in cloud environment. There are concerned three aspects on which we will compare algorithms: (i) Avalanche Effect: - small changes in plaintext or key will change the cipher text is known as advance effect. Either change in on bit of plaintext or key will change no. bits of output value. (ii )Memory required: - Different algorithms required different memory space to perform the operation. The memor y space required by any algorithm is determined on the basis of data size, no. of rounds etc. From different algorithm an algorithm is consider best which use small memory and perform best task. (iii) Simulation time: - The time required consumed by algorithm to complete the operation is known as simulation time. It depends on processor speed, algorithm complexity. Small simulation time is desirable requirement . There is considered implementation of cryptographic algorithms in cloud environment by using software libraries and simulators. Finally, there are discussed some possibilities to maximize the speed of execution of cryptographic algorithms, emphasize the importan ce of parallelization of algorithms.
